Overview

Technological determinism is the thesis that technology is the primary driver of social, cultural, and historical change: that technologies develop according to their own internal logic, and that societies must adapt to the technological changes that sweep over them. On the determinist view, the printing press created the Reformation, the factory created industrial society, the automobile created suburbia, and the internet created the networked age — not because anyone chose these outcomes, but because the technologies themselves made them unavoidable.

The thesis comes in two strengths. Hard determinism holds that technological change is the independent variable of history: technology develops autonomously, and society follows wherever it leads. Soft determinism holds that technology strongly constrains social development — it sets the range of possibilities, shapes the options, and biases outcomes — while allowing that societies have some latitude in how they respond. Most contemporary philosophers who defend a determinist position defend the soft version; the hard version functions largely as a target for critique.

Technological determinism matters because it shapes how we think about responsibility. If technology drives society, then technological change is something that happens to us, and the task of politics is adaptation, not choice. If, on the contrary, technologies are shaped by social forces, then technological development is a domain of human agency and democratic decision — and we are responsible for the world our technologies make. The debate between determinism and its critics is therefore a debate about the possibility of governing technology.

Core Principles

The first principle of technological determinism is the principle of technological autonomy: technology develops according to its own logic — the logic of efficiency, capability, and progress — rather than according to human choices. Jacques Ellul gave the strongest statement of this principle: technique, the totality of methods oriented toward maximum efficiency, is autonomous; it selects for the most efficient solution regardless of human values, and it absorbs every attempt to control it into itself.

The second principle is the principle of causal primacy: technology is the fundamental cause of social change. Social structures, cultural values, and political institutions are, in the last analysis, adaptations to the technological base. This principle has a Marxist lineage — Marx argued that "the hand-mill gives you society with the feudal lord; the steam-mill, society with the industrial capitalist" — though Marx himself insisted that social relations also shape technological development.

The third principle is the principle of inevitability: technological development follows a trajectory that is, in its main lines, predictable and unstoppable. This principle underlies the rhetoric of "progress," the fatalism that greets every new technology ("you can't stop it"), and the politics of adaptation. Its critics note that inevitability is often a rhetorical move rather than an empirical claim: describing a technology as inevitable forecloses the question of whether it should be adopted.

The fourth principle is the principle of neutrality: technology itself is value-free, and its effects follow from its nature rather than from the intentions of its users. This principle sits in tension with the autonomy thesis — if technology is neutral, it is hard to see how it has a direction — and the two are often combined loosely in popular determinism: technology is neutral in the abstract, but its own logic determines its effects.

Key Thinkers

Marshall McLuhan is the most famous determinist in the medium-theoretic tradition. His claim that "the medium is the message" is a determinist thesis: the form of a medium — not its content, not the intentions of its users — determines the shape of perception, culture, and society. The alphabet creates the individual; the printing press creates the nation; electronic media create the global village. McLuhan's determinism is soft but deep: media do not compel specific outcomes so much as reconfigure the conditions of experience within which all outcomes occur.

Jacques Ellul is the strongest determinist of the twentieth century. In The Technological Society, he argued that technique has become the determining force of modern life: autonomous, self-augmenting, and indifferent to human values. Ellul's determinism is total: every domain of life — politics, education, culture, religion — has been colonized by technical imperatives, and attempts to resist are absorbed into the system.

Martin Heidegger's account of enframing has determinist implications: technology is not a neutral instrument but a mode of revealing that configures how everything appears, and the essence of technology — the ordering, optimizing relation to reality — tends to become the universal relation. Heidegger's determinism is metaphysical rather than sociological: technology is a destiny, a historical sending, which human beings can at best meet with a "free relation" but cannot simply control.

Historical Development

The intellectual ancestry of technological determinism reaches back to the Enlightenment faith in progress: if reason and science advance according to their own logic, and society is transformed in their wake, then the course of history is set by the advance of knowledge and technique. The nineteenth century gave the thesis its classic formulations: Marx's historical materialism made the mode of production the foundation of society; the idea of "progress" made technological advance appear as the engine of history itself.

The twentieth century produced both the strongest statements and the strongest critiques. The pessimists of the interwar and postwar periods — Ellul, Heidegger, Lewis Mumford — concluded from the devastation of industrial warfare that technology had escaped human control. At the same time, the emerging field of the history of technology began to document the ways technologies were shaped by economic, political, and cultural forces, laying the groundwork for the critique of determinism.

The decisive turn came in the 1980s with the development of the social construction of technology (SCOT). If technologies are socially constructed — shaped by the negotiations of social groups, by interpretive flexibility, by the contingencies of design — then determinism is false as a description of technological development, and the political question of technology opens up again. The debate between determinists and social constructionists remains the central controversy of the philosophy of technology.

Contemporary Relevance

Technological determinism has returned to prominence in the age of AI and the internet. The claim that "AI is inevitable," that "the internet cannot be governed," that "algorithms are neutral," and that "technology is developing faster than our ability to regulate it" are all determinist claims in popular form. They function to move decisions out of the domain of politics and into the domain of fate.

The philosophical stakes are practical. If technology is autonomous and inevitable, then the appropriate response to AI, surveillance, and automation is adaptation — and those who raise questions are resisting the inevitable. If, on the contrary, technology is socially shaped, then AI development is a domain of collective choice: what we build, how we build it, who benefits, and who decides are political questions, and democratic institutions have a role in answering them. The critique of determinism — the insistence that technologies are made by people and can be made otherwise — is the philosophical foundation of technology governance.

Sources

The foundational academic sources for technological determinism are the Stanford Encyclopedia of Philosophy's entry on the Philosophy of Technology, which surveys the determinism debate from Marx to SCOT, and its entry on Martin Heidegger. The classic critical study is Technological Determinism in American Culture (Cornell University Press), edited by Merritt Roe Smith and Leo Marx, which examines both the determinist thesis and its history.
